Table 5.

Predictors for bipolar disorder in different states by multivariate analysis.

B S.E p value Odds ratio 95% CI
Lower limit Upper limit
HG vs BD
MON 5.083 0.971 <0.0001 161.257 24.065 1080.585
hs-CRP 0.174 0.073 0.018 1.190 1.031 1.374
NLR 1.036 0.327 0.002 2.819 1.484 5.354
Constant 2.151 1.168 0.065 8.593
HG vs BD-M
MON 5.375 1.011 <0.0001 215.916 29.737 1567.718
hs-CRP 0.211 0.084 0.012 1.235 1.048 1.457
NLR 1.022 0.335 0.002 2.779 1.440 5.360
Constant 1.520 1.291 0.239 4.571
HG vs BD-D
NLR 0.544 0.200 0.006 1.723 1.165 2.549
MHR 4.208 1.066 <0.0001 67.212 8.322 542.860
Constant 3.244 1.495 0.030 25.632
HG vs BD with mixed features
MON 5.454 1.718 0.001 233.805 8.065 6778.348
Constant −4.308 0.822 <0.0001 0.013

HG, Healthy group; BD, bipolar disorder; BD-M, bipolar disorder manic episodes; BD-D, bipolar disorder depressive episodes; BD with mixed features, bipolar disorder with mixed features; MON, monocyte; hs-CRP, hypersensitive C-reactive protein; NLR, Neutrophil-to-lymphocyte ratio; MHR, Monocyte-to-HDL ratio.
